Academic Enrichment Services
The academic services department offers knowledgeable and supportive academic counselors, as well as tutoring at no charge in many subject areas. First-year students meet regularly with professional academic consultants. Continuing support is available throughout the undergraduate years. Our academic services have helped bring about outstanding student retention and graduation rates for opportunity program students at Ithaca College.

LGBT Resource Center
The Center for LGBT Education, Outreach, and Services, located on the ground floor of the Hammond Health Center , actively fosters the personal growth and academic success of LGBT students. A coordinator and trained student volunteers staff the LGBT resource center, offering books, videos, periodicals, and computer stations in a welcoming and supportive environment. CSLI-Student Leadership Institute
The Student Leadership Institute develops and trains OMA students to attain excellence in leadership roles within and outside the College community. Students participate in a series of seminars; attend an annual retreat and workshops throughout the academic year. For more information please visit www.ithaca.edu/csli
